If you’ve ever craved perfectly cooked fluffy rice without the fuss, then you need this Instant Pot Basmati Rice Recipe in your life. It’s straightforward, quick, and delivers beautifully light and fragrant grains every single time. Whether you’re whipping up a midweek meal or hosting friends for dinner, this recipe will become your secret weapon for making basmati rice that pairs seamlessly with countless dishes.

Ingredients You’ll Need
Don’t be fooled by the simplicity here; each ingredient plays a crucial role in elevating the perfect texture and flavor of your basmati rice. Keeping it simple allows the natural aroma and nutty flavor of the rice to shine through.
- 1 cup basmati rice: Choose good quality rice for fluffy, separate grains that don’t clump together.
- 1 ¼ cups water: This precise liquid amount ensures your rice cooks evenly without being mushy or dry.
- 1 Tbsp. butter (optional): Adds a subtle richness and silky texture to the rice without overpowering the natural flavor.
- ½ tsp. salt (plus more to taste): Enhances all the flavors and balances the inherent sweetness of the basmati rice.
How to Make Instant Pot Basmati Rice Recipe
Step 1: Rinse the Rice
Place your basmati rice in a fine mesh strainer and rinse it thoroughly under cold water for about a minute until the water runs clear. This step removes excess starch that causes clumping and results in wonderfully fluffy, separated grains.
Step 2: Combine Ingredients in the Instant Pot
Transfer the rinsed rice into your 6-quart Instant Pot and add the water, butter if you’re using it, and salt. This simple combination is the magic formula for perfectly cooked basmati rice every time.
Step 3: Pressure Cook the Rice
Seal your Instant Pot lid and set the pressure release valve to the sealed position. Select the pressure cook or manual function and set the timer for 6 minutes on high pressure. While the pot takes about 5 to 10 minutes to pressurize, the anticipation builds for that fantastic, fluffy rice.
Step 4: Natural Pressure Release
When the cooking timer ends, be patient and let the pressure release naturally for 10 minutes. This resting period allows the rice to finish absorbing moisture without becoming mushy. Afterward, carefully switch the valve to venting to release any remaining steam before opening the lid.
Step 5: Fluff and Serve
The last step is the most satisfying. Grab a fork and gently fluff the rice to separate the grains. Look at those fragrant, perfectly cooked basmati grains — ready to elevate your meal instantly.
How to Serve Instant Pot Basmati Rice Recipe
Garnishes
Elevate your Instant Pot Basmati Rice Recipe with fresh chopped herbs like cilantro, parsley, or mint for a pop of color and brightness. Toasted nuts or seeds like almonds or sesame seeds also add texture and a subtle nutty flavor that complements the rice beautifully.
Side Dishes
Basmati rice is incredibly versatile and the ideal companion to a wide range of dishes. Serve it alongside rich curries, grilled meats, sautéed vegetables, or even a vibrant vegetable stir-fry for a balanced, colorful plate.
Creative Ways to Present
Try molding your Instant Pot Basmati Rice Recipe with a small bowl or ramekin, then invert it onto your serving plate for a neat, elegant presentation. You can even mix in some saffron or turmeric to add a lovely golden hue and subtly different flavor.
Make Ahead and Storage
Storing Leftovers
Store any leftover basmati rice in an airtight container in the refrigerator; it will stay fresh and ready to use for up to 4 days. Make sure it cools completely before sealing to avoid moisture buildup.
Freezing
If you want to keep your Instant Pot Basmati Rice Recipe longer, freezing is a great option. Portion the rice into freezer-safe bags or containers, removing as much air as possible. Frozen rice stays good for up to 3 months.
Reheating
To reheat, sprinkle your rice with a little water and cover it to trap steam, either in the microwave or on the stove. This helps refresh the rice and brings back that just-cooked fluffiness effortlessly.
FAQs
Can I double the rice and water quantities?
Absolutely! You can easily double or triple the recipe, but make sure your Instant Pot has enough capacity. The cook time remains the same; just be careful not to overfill the pot beyond the maximum fill line.
Do I have to rinse the basmati rice?
Rinsing is highly recommended because it removes starch that can cause the rice to be sticky or gummy. Clean, rinsed rice always cooks up lighter and fluffier.
Is butter necessary in this recipe?
The butter is optional but adds a lovely richness and smooth texture. If you prefer a dairy-free version, substitute with a tablespoon of oil or simply omit it altogether.
Can I use brown basmati rice instead?
Brown basmati rice requires longer cooking times and more water, so this particular recipe won’t work perfectly with it. Look for a dedicated brown rice Instant Pot recipe for best results.
What if I don’t have an Instant Pot? Can I make this on the stovetop?
You certainly can, but the method and cooking times differ quite a bit. The Instant Pot Basmati Rice Recipe shines because of the even pressure cooking that guarantees consistent texture with minimal effort.
Final Thoughts
This Instant Pot Basmati Rice Recipe has become one of my kitchen staples because it delivers the perfect balance of simplicity, speed, and flavor. Once you try it, you’ll wonder how you ever managed without it. It’s perfect for everyday meals or special dinners and is guaranteed to become a go-to whenever you want that flawless serving of basmati rice.
Print
Instant Pot Basmati Rice Recipe
- Prep Time: 2 minutes
- Cook Time: 26 minutes
- Total Time: 28 minutes
- Yield: 6 servings
- Category: Side Dish
- Method: Instant Pot
- Cuisine: Indian
- Diet: Gluten Free
Description
A quick and simple recipe for perfectly cooked, fluffy basmati rice using an Instant Pot. This method ensures each grain is separate and tender, making it an ideal side for a variety of dishes.
Ingredients
Ingredients
- 1 cup basmati rice
- 1 ¼ cups water
- 1 Tbsp. butter (optional)
- ½ tsp. salt (plus more to taste)
Instructions
- Rinse the Rice: Place rice in a fine mesh strainer and rinse under cold water for 1 minute or until the water runs clear to remove excess starch and prevent clumping.
- Combine Ingredients in Instant Pot: Add the rinsed rice, water, butter or oil if using, and salt into a 6-quart Instant Pot.
- Set Pressure Cooking: Secure the Instant Pot lid and set the pressure release valve to the sealed position. Select the pressure cook or manual setting and set the timer to 6 minutes at high pressure. Note that it will take approximately 5-10 minutes for the Instant Pot to reach full pressure.
- Natural Pressure Release: After the cooking time is complete, let the Instant Pot release pressure naturally for 10 minutes. Then carefully move the valve to venting to release any remaining steam. Open the lid once the float valve drops down.
- Fluff and Serve: Use a fork to gently fluff the rice to separate the grains. Serve immediately for best texture and flavor.
Notes
- Rinsing the rice thoroughly removes excess surface starch and helps achieve fluffy rice.
- Adding butter or oil enhances flavor but is optional.
- Adjust salt quantity to taste or dietary preference.
- For best results, use a 6-quart or larger Instant Pot to avoid overflow.
- Allowing natural pressure release helps finish cooking the rice gently without drying it out.

